What Is Chiropractic Care?


In actual terms, the word Chiropractic actually indicates to be done by hand. So, the term chiropractic care would suggest to give care through using the hands. A post by WebMD entitled Chiropractic Care for Neck and back pain thoroughly went over more on chiropractic care and what chiropractors do.

Chiropractors use hands-on spinal adjustment and other alternative treatments. The theory is that appropriate alignment of the body'& #39; s musculoskeletal structure, especially the spine, will make it possible for the body to heal itself without surgical treatment or medication. Adjustment is used to restore mobility to joints limited by tissue injury caused by a terrible occasion, such as falling, or repeated stress, such as sitting without correct back support.

Chiropractic treatment is primarily utilized as a pain relief alternative for muscles, joints, bones, and connective tissue, such as cartilage, ligaments, and tendons. It is sometimes used in combination with standard medical treatment.

As formerly specified by the post, chiropractors are individuals who can carry out chiropractic care and adjustment. They control the spine and other skeletal parts to bring relief and bring back movement in the joints. To cover the whole concept up, chiropractic care is ideally provided for pain relief in muscles, joints, bones, and connective tissues and often can be utilized as standard medical treatment.

What Does A Chiropractor Do?


When people talk about Chiropractic care or chiropractors in general, they generally think of bone-cracking or perhaps massage. Still, there are a variety of things that a Chiropractor does than just that. Cleveland Center shared their expertise in this article, more discussing the strategies and techniques that Chiropractors recommend as a treatment for their clients.

Soft-tissue therapy is a recommended treatment utilized to unwind tight muscles, alleviate spasm and release tension in the fascia (the connective tissue that surrounds each muscle). Meanwhile, adjustments are made to straighten joints carefully and increase the series of movement. Another approach is joint bracing/taping, also called Kinesio taping, which is done to support sprained joints or muscles as they heal. Chiropractors also recommend stretching and exercises to restore and preserve movement, as well as the variety of movement of their customers. And suppose Chiropractors believe that a customer requires more than chiropractic care. In that case, they refer their customers to integrative medication specialists for guidance on diet and nutrition to lower inflammation and promote weight reduction.

Unlike many others think, chiropractors not only make manual adjustment with their hands but likewise share the very same mental input as physicians to discuss the very best course of treatment for their customers.

What Else Should I Learn About Chiropractic Care?


People often think that when going to a Chiropractor and is performed with manual changes, the problem instantly disappears. However, this isn't typically the case. Effectively Health author Anne Asher, CPT, released a short article entitled What You Must Know About Chiropractic Adjustments and discussed what patients would anticipate when going to the Chiropractor.

While it's real that the mainstay of the chiropractic occupation is the adjustment of the spine, most chiropractors adjust the pelvis as a routine part of treatment. Some also adjust knees, feet, and wrists. You may require numerous check outs to get the preferred results.

Lots of associate cracking and popping with an effective chiropractic adjustment. In truth, these noises might have absolutely nothing to do with an accurate realignment of your joints. Rather, they are believed to be a result of cavitationwhen gasses in the joint'& #39; s lubricating fluid are launched into the "joint area" in between the bones.

Other individuals would think that a person visit to the Chiropractors clinic would resolve all their issues, however thats not always real. Clients may need more than one see to the Chiropractor to solve any pain or pain that they feel.

Sciatica Symptoms and causes

Sciatica Nerve Pain Manifestations and causes what causes sciatic nerve pain Sciatica Comprehensive summary covers symptoms, treatment of this intense back, pelvic and leg pain.

Sciatica Symptoms and causes what triggers sciatic nerve pain

Sciatica is a condition specified by pain radiating from your lower back to your hips and buttocks down your leg. Normally, people experiencing sciatica just feel it on one side of the body. A spinal disc herniation, which is defined by a bone stimulate on the spine, or a weakening of the spine (spinal stenosis) compresses part of the nerve, triggering sciatica. The affected leg is identified by pain, discomfort, and feeling numb.

Regardless of the intensity of the pain, many patients will heal with non-operative treatments in a couple of weeks. Patients who suffer from persistent sciatica and have considerable leg disability or bowel or bladder modification might be prospects for surgical treatment due to sciatica symptomsonce they figure out the reason for sciatica.

Signs and Signs

An individual with sciatica signs feels pain radiating from the lower (back) spine to their butt and down their body. There is no guaranteed area where the pain happens, however it will most likely be somewhere in your nerve path, its most likely to occur along a line ranging from your low back to your buttocks, along with along the back of your thigh and calf. Depending upon the seriousness, the pain can be dull, intense, burning, or excruciating. Periodically, it can seem like an electric shock or a shock. Sitting for prolonged periods of time can worsen signs, as can coughing and sneezing. Affected sides are normally either the right or left. Affected legs or feet may also experience pain, tingling, or tightness. It may seem like you are experiencing pain in one region of your leg while feeling numb in another those are common sciatica signs.

When to see a medical professional

Mild sciatica symptoms typically disappears with time. See your doctor if youre experiencing pain that lasts more than a week, is serious or aggravates in time, or if you generally do not feel better after self-care interventions. Whenever you experience any of the signs noted below, get medical attention as soon as possible.

The leg numbs or is stiff and you feel severe, extreme pain in the low back or the leg.Theres no control over your bladder or bowels.

Causes

Sciatica is caused by a pinched sciatic nerve, which is typically triggered by a spinal disc herniation on your back or a bone stimulate on among your vertebrae. The nerve can be compressed by a growth or affected by conditions such as diabetes.

Spinal stenosis, or constricting of spaces in the spinal cord, can also be responsible for sciatica. When a nerves passage is narrowed, the narrowing area might provide off an irritating impact on the sciatic nerve root that might then trigger Sciatica. Compression of the disks triggers a constricting of the nerve passageways (spinal stenosis). If the sciatic nerve roots are pinched by spinal stenosis, they can cause pain.

An injury to the nerve origin by a herniated or slipped disk. A lot of sciatica cases are because of this condition. Each vertebra of the spine is cushioned by a disk. Herniation can occur when a weak spot in a disks external wall enables pressure from vertebrae to trigger it to bulge (herniate). The sciatic nerve is impacted when a herniated disk presses versus the vertebrae in the lower back.

Spondylolisthesis takes place when the vertebrae are misaligned with one another, leading to a smaller sized gap from which nerves are exited. Extending the spine can make the sciatic nerve pinched.

Arthritis of the knee, which is called osteoarthritis. When a spine ages, bone stimulates may form (rugged edges), which can compress the lower back nerves.

Sciatic nerve or lumbar spine trauma.

Compression of the sciatic nerve by tumors in the back spinal canal.

A condition known as piriformis syndrome results from an overactive or spastic piriformis muscle, deep in the buttocks. Sciatic nerves can end up being irritated and put under pressure when this takes place. Neuromuscular disorders such as Piriformis syndrome are unusual.

Diagnosis

An assessment of your medical history will be carried out by your healthcare company. Later, you will need to describe your signs to your healthcare provider.

As part of your physical examination, your doctor will ask you to walk to identify how your spine supports your weight. The strength of your calf muscles might be checked by having you stroll on your toes and heels. Its possible that your doctor will perform a straight leg raise test also. Your legs should be straight while resting on your back for this test. When you raise each leg slowly, your care service providers will note the point where you feel pain.

Tests like these determine which nerves are impacted along with whether a disk has an issue. Additional stretches and movements will also be asked so the doctor can identify pain as well as test muscle flexibility and strength.

In some cases, imaging and other tests will be recommended by your doctor after your physical examination. There are several possibilities here to discover sciatica causes, including:

  • Spinal X-rays: Required to identify fractures, disk issues, infections, tumors, and bone spurs.

  • Magnetic Resonance Imaging (MRI) or Computed Tomography (CT) scans: Computed tomography (CT) or magnetic resonance imaging (MRI) scans of the back may be utilized to see detailed images of bone and soft tissues related to the back. MRI can determine pressure on a nerve, arthritic conditions, disk herniation that might continue a nerve. An MRI is generally regularly bought to validate a medical diagnosis of sciatica.

  • Nerve conduction velocity studies/electromyography: Studies of the conduction speed of the sciatic nerve and electromyography to take a look at how electrical impulses travel through the sciatic nerve and how muscle contractions are affected.

  • Myelogram: A myelogram can be utilized to determine if the pain originates from the vertebrae or disk.

Several typical factors may affect the sciatic nerve:

Mechanical Nerve Compression: Direct physical forces may be applied to the nerve due to the following common conditions:

Herniated Discs: The lumbar spine can be affected by a herniated or bulging disc that compresses the sciatic nerve.

Foraminal Stenosis: Compression or irritation of the sciatic nerve might result from narrowing of the vertebral column or from contracting the roots of the sciatic nerve. Degenerative modifications in the spine might straight compress the sciatic nerve when thickened ligaments and/or pills within the facet joint.

Segmental Instability: In certain conditions, such as when a vertebra slides on top of another (spondylolisthesis), when there are vertebral problems (spondylolysis), or when one or more bones dislocate, the sciatic nerve root(s) are directly compressed.

Growths, Cysts, Infection, & Abscesses: The sciatic nerve can be compressed by growths, cysts, infections, or abscesses impacting the lower spine or pelvis in rare instances

Chemical Inflammation: The sciatic nerve may experience inflammation and/or irritation due to chemical irritants. Degenerate or herniated discs might trigger nerve tissues to turn into the disc and permeate the external and inner layers, causing sciatica pain. These irritants might also be brought on by acids such as hyaluronic acid and proteins such as fibronectin (proteins).

Immune Reaction: Herniated discs that expose disc material might trigger sciatica pain because of immune responses. Those with sciatica tend to produce a lot of compounds produced by the body immune system, including glycosphingolipids (fats) and neurofilaments (protein polymers). This inflammation is thought to arise from chemicals launched between the nerve roots and exposed disc material in action to inflammation.

Physical Attributes: The sciatic nerve might be affected by certain physical qualities of an individual. Sciatica is more likely to be seen in individuals who:

  • Overweight or overweight individuals

  • Senior individuals who have big stature (usually over 180 cm for males and 170 cm for women)

Work-Related Causes: Sciatica pain is more common among people with particular occupationsfor example, truck motorists, machine workers, woodworkers, and weight-lifting professional athletes. Usually, sciatica happens when the spine is exposed to prolonged sitting without appropriate posture when the upper arms are typically raised above shoulder level, and/or when the spine is frequently bent forward or sideways.

Nutritional Shortage in Vitamin B12: Keeping nerve health needs adequate vitamin B12 consumption. The B12 vitamin plays an important function in synthesizing the fatty sheath (myelin) that surrounds nerves. This is very important for nerve function and the conduction of nerve impulses. Those who are older than 60 and who are lacking in vitamin B12 might develop sciatica. Metabolic malabsorption might additionally trigger vitamin B12 deficiencies in individuals with diabetes who take metformin.

Treatment

What you do depends on whats triggering your sciatic nerve pain. If it ends up that you have a herniated disc in your spine, there are several various kinds of treatments. Consult professional medical guidance or seek medical attention to prevent sciatica from getting even worse, which might cause permanent nerve damage.

For severe sciatica and persistent sciatica, consider these health solutions:

Medicine:Sciatica can be temporarily alleviated with over-the-counter painkiller. In addition to acetaminophen, n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ory drugs (NSAIDs) such as aspirin, ibuprofen, and naproxen are readily available. To even more minimize inflammation, your doctor may administer an injection of steroids.

Physical Therapy or Stretching: Preserve an active way of life while your sciatica is recovery. Pain and swelling can be reduced through movement. Find out how to stretch the hamstrings and lower back gently with the aid of a physical therapist. You can reinforce your core and stabilize the affected area by practicing Tai Chi or Yoga. In many cases, you may not be able to do specific exercises due to your medical condition. You may likewise be recommended to take brief walks by your medical professional.

Surgical treatment: After 4 to 6 weeks, if you are still suffering from serious sciatica pain due to a herniated disk, surgical treatment might be an option. Surgery is performed to ease pressure on the sciatic nerve by getting rid of a portion of the herniated disk. In about 90% of cases, this kind of surgical treatment relieves the patients pain. Sciatica due to spinal stenosis can be treated with other surgeries.
